Book Description

Model Railroader May 1995
Presents scale modeling details that make layouts more interesting. Includes practical, effective tips and techniques for improving the realism of buildings, scenery, and backdrops.

More About the Author

Dave Frary has been an active professional model railroad builder, author, photographer, and instructor for more than 45 years.

His photos, plans and stories have appeared in Model Railroader, Railroad Model Craftsman, Classic Toy Trains, Great Model Railroads, The Short Line & Narrow Gauge Gazette, FineScale Modeler, Model Railroading, Toy Update, 009 News, and many other publications. His industrial photos have been used by model manufacturers, by N.A.S.A. and in dozens of non-railroad brochures, annual reports, record album covers, and advertisements.

Dave's model railroads have toured the USA, are located in Tokyo Disneyland, several museums, retail stores, private homes, and have been used in TV and motion picture productions.

Dave has authored seven books on scenery building, model building and model photography, and has produced seven DVD's. His web site is www.mrscenery.com.

5.0 out of 5 stars An excellent book from exceptional modelers, December 11, 2008
This review is from: 303 Tips for Detailing Model Railroad Scenery and Structures (Model Railroader) (Paperback)
I've been a major fan of authors/modelers Frary and Hayden since their series on building the Thatchers Inlet RR published in Railroad Model Craftsman back when I was... well, a lot younger than I am now. These guys and the late, great John Allen are stellar lights in the history of the hobby, as far as I'm concerned.

This book is a collection of clever tips, tricks and pointers for both the beginner and the aspiring journeyman. I've been building models off and on for over 40 years and I find something of value every time I pick up the book.

Another plus, it's actually fun to read! The authors have a scope of knowledge that never overpowers their sense of whimsy and humor (as an example, look closely at the picture of the steamroller in action).
